Social critic and novelist Charles Dickens -
The plot of his every book so interestingly thickens!
Not only the creator of Scrooge was he;
He revived the Christmas spirit for you and for me.

Mr. Ebenezer Scrooge
The 'Fourth Stooge'
   Three were hilarious
   The fourth, nefarious

Rudolph The Red Nosed Reindeer
helped Santa out one year.
To keep his nose lit steady,
he used an Everready!
